About 69 Mattison Road
69 Mattison Road is a mid-terrace house in Haringey, London, London (N4 1BQ). It has a recorded floor area of 163 m² (around 1755 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(May 2014)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 70),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Held since October 2004 — that's 22 years off the open market, well above the local norm. At 163 m² the property is well over the postcode median (65 m² across 16 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 88%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£902,000 sits 165.3% above the 2004 sale of £339,950.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£194/sq ft) was about 45.9% below the postcode norm.
